How do you get silver Lab puppies?

The recessive gene is called the ‘dilution gene’ because it dilutes the coat color of the dog. For example, Chocolate Labs are usually a pure brown color. If a Chocolate Lab has two recessive genes, this dilutes the normally solid color into a lighter version. This produces a Silver Lab.

What determines the color of lab puppies?

Both types get their color from a pigment called eumelanin. Labs with lots of eumelanin pigment in their coat are black. If they have a little less, they appear brown instead. The genetic instruction for being black or brown is held at the B locus in a dog’s DNA.

What color puppies will 2 chocolate labs have?

Mating two chocolate Labradors: Two brown dogs mated together will never throw black puppies because brown dogs do not have the black gene. But two chocolate dogs can produce yellow puppies, if each of the parents carries the little e gene – see the bottom right hand box below.

How much is a silver lab puppy?

While pure Chocolate Labs, Yellow Labs, and Black Labs from reputable breeders may cost anywhere from $500 to $1000, Silver Lab puppies typically sell for $800 to $1500.

Can a chocolate lab have silver puppies?

Yes and no. There are two types of “silver Labradors. The first type is a Labrador with a dilute recessive d gene. It’s actually a Chocolate Labrador.

Why are silver Labradors bad?

Silver Labs suffer from the same health issues as other purebred Labs. Including a predisposition to joint problems and to over-eating! On balance though, Labs are a fairly healthy and well constructed breed, free from some of the disabilities that plague some other purebred dogs.

Are Silver Labs born black?

What does a Silver Lab (Silver Labrador Retriever) look like? Aside from their distinctive silver color, most of these Silver Lab dogs have light brown noses. When born, Silver Lab puppies usually have blue eyes and their eyes will change to a light yellow as they mature at around the age of 8 months to a year old.
